Sabbam Hari asks Naidu to topple Govt
11 Oct 2012 6:50 AM
Anakapalli Congress party MP Sabbam Hari today said
TDP president Chandrababu Naidu has been protecting the Congress government
which has failed on all fronts and asked him to topple the Kirankumar Reddy
Government by introducing a no-confidence motion in the assembly instead of continuing
with his Yatra.
Speaking to reporters after meeting YSRCP chief
Y.S. Jagan Mohan Reddy in the Chanchalguda jail in Hyderabad, Hari said the
Congress Government should go but the opposition leader Chandrababu Naidu is
not doing anything to topple it.
“On the
one hand, he is telling that the Government has failed on all fronts but on the
other he has failed to introduce the no-confidence motion in the assembly. If
he doesn’t want the Government to continue, Naidu should have introduced the
no-confidence motion and toppled the Government,” Sabbam Hari asked.
Chandrababu Naidu’s party has 90 MLAs and he can
topple the Government by introducing the no-confidence motion, Hari said,
adding, instead of showing the door to the Kiran Kumar Reddy Government, Naidu
has just hit the roads.
Earlier, Hari met Jagan in the Chanchalguda jail
and expressed his moral support to him.
